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65536 71327308 91943690238
0041 6829250928 4298093
0041 6829250928 4298093
88345379064 203 970325938
All about undefined
Interested in learning more?
0041 6829250928 4298093
88345379064 203 970325938
See more
0521717 256772 34587
81844954958 85206878 0360379577
See more
265665 397038025
56458 3525 97905813
See more